Chowan Swimming Grabs Four All-Conference Selections

Ashley Mayes, 100 Fly Champion

2/26/2021 9:42:00 PM

KINGSPORT, TENN. – Day two of the 2021 Conference Carolinas Swimming Championships was productive for the Chowan Swimming program picking up an individual championship and three other all-conference selections on Friday.

INSIDE THE LANES

Ashley Mayes took home the championship in the 100 fly after breaking the school and conference record in the event during the prelims.

Jersey Razzano and Igor Proszynski tallied Third Team All-Conference selections in the 1000 Free.

The Chowan women's 800 free relay earned Third Team All-Conference honots.

HOW IT HAPPENED

200 Medley Relay:

Chowan Women finished fourth with a time of 1:51.25.  Ashley Mayes, Zorey Sargent, Jasmine Gibson, and Grace Arredondo swam for the Hawks.

For the men, Christian Oleaga, Marshall Stevens, Andrew Simmons, and Tristan Stinson posted a fourth place finish with a time of 1:38.71.  The relay was just off the pace the 2020 relay posted for a school record.

1000 Free:

Jersey Razzano swam to a school record in the prelims and improved on that time with a time of 11:01.11 to finish third overall and claim Third Team All-Conference honors.  Marissa Mann finished eighth overall.

Igor Proszynski earned a Third Team All-Conference selection finishing third in the event with a time of 10:02.58.

400 IM:

After improving on his school record time during the prelims (4:24.04), Lucas Pels improved even more to post a time of 4:22.21 to finish 10th overall.  David Clark finished behind Pels with a time of 4:35.56 for the second best time in program history.

100 Fly:

Ashley Mayes recorded a school and conference record in the event during the prelims with a time of 56.24 and just missed the NCAA Qualifying "B" standard time (56.04).  Mayes would follow up her time with a championship pace with a time of 56.50.

Brinna Houlahan posted the seventh best time in program history with a time of 1:04.15.

Justin Lough posted the second best time in program history with a time of 52.87 in the event.  Lough finished eighth overall.

200 Free:

Grace Arredondo finished sixth overall with a time of 2:03.33.  Atar Idrissi finished 10th with a time of 2:10.43.

100 Breast:

Zorey Sargent finished first in the "B" finals with a time of 1:10.97 and ninth overall.  Jeleah Delancy posted a time of 1:14.49 and MacKenzie Lucy posted a time of 1:15.50.

Marshall Stevens posted a time of 1:02.20 to finish 11th overall.  Kyle Sheridan touched the wall with a time of 1:13.68.

100 Back:

James Cameron posted a time of 56.12 to finish ninth overall.  Andrew Simmons (58.39) and Christian Oleaga (58.69) posted the third and fourth best times in program history respectively.

Anquniece Wheeler posted the eighth best time in program history in the event with a time of 1:07.34 to finish 12th overall.

800 Free Relay:

The Women earned Third Team All-Conference honors as Grace Arredondo, Zorey Sargent, Jersey Razzano, and Ashley Mayes posted a time of 8:12.14.

Igor Proszynski, Andrew Simmons, Marshall Stevens, and Christian Oleaga posted a fifth place finish with a time of 7:41.56.
